14.454 Macroeconomic Theory IV, Fall 2004
(2004-12)
This half-term course covers the macroeconomic implications of imperfections in labor markets, goods markets, credit and financial markets. The role of nominal rigidities is also an area of focus.
ESD.801 Leadership Development, Fall 2004
(2004-12)
Presents basic concepts in group dynamics and leadership. A structured set of outdoor experiences complements classroom activities. Restricted to entering students in the Technology and Policy Program.
